Alzheimer's and other dementias
Dementia, one of the major causes of disability and dependency among older people worldwide, is a collective name for progressive brain syndromes that affect memory, thinking, orientation, comprehension and behaviour. There are many forms of dementia, including Alzheimer’s disease, vascular dementia and Lewy body dementia. Worldwide, close to 50 million people have dementia and 7.7 million new cases are expected every year. Although dementia mainly affects older people, it is not a normal part of ageing.
